The Therapeutic Power of Acupuncture: Exploring MTC's Techniques
Acupuncture, a cornerstone of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M), utilizes fine needles inserted at specific acupoints on the body to stimulate the flow of Qi, or vital energy. MTC practitioners assert that imbalances in Qi can produce various health concerns. By balancing the flow of Qi, acupuncture aims to promote natural healing and alleviate a wide range of conditions.
Acupuncturists carefully choose acupuncture locations based on an individual's specific health history. A typical session may comprise the insertion and manipulation of needles at various points along the body's meridians. The experience is often described as a subtle sensation, or even a feeling of calmness.
Studies indicate that acupuncture may be effective for addressing a variety of disorders, including headaches, nausea, anxiety, and insomnia. ,Additionally, acupuncture is often used as a complementary therapy to enhance conventional medical treatments.
The effectiveness of acupuncture varies on individual factors such as the nature of the condition, the skill of the practitioner, and the recipient's overall health status. Consult a qualified TCM practitioner to determine if acupuncture is an appropriate option for your wellness aspirations.
